Because of moderate incomes and increased costs of living, many people seek other alternatives for making ends meet. Owning a business is an effective way of boosting your income. Of course, for achieving a successful new business venture, there must be a need. Although many people have the entrepreneurial spirit, very few have the capital required to operate their own business. There are several business ventures that can be started with little or no money down, for example, an office cleaning business.

Starting an office cleaning business is simple, and requires little start-up capital. The only expense involves buying supplies and advertising. Fortunately, cleaning supplies are cheap, and it costs even less to pass out flyers or advertise in local newspapers. Because most business professionals are busy, they are willing to pay a company or individual to clean their offices. Here are some reasons why you should start an office cleaning business

As a business owner, you decide how big you want the business to grow. For example, if a smaller operation is preferred, you may decide to clean the offices yourself or hire one or two employees. On the other hand, some owners have goals of building the office cleaning business into an extremely profitable, well-known company. In this instance, you might consider buying into a cleaning franchise.

Because many companies and small offices are always in search of office cleaning professionals, finding contracts is simple. Nonetheless, you must be willing to put in a little footwork. Posting flyers and advertising is effective. However, if looking for immediate contracts that will start bringing in cash by the beginning of next week, print up a few business cards, informational sheets, and introduce yourself to business owners.

Office cleaning professionals have the power to set their own work hours. You can work as little, or as much as you like. Moreover, you may choose to manage the business, while other people do the cleaning. In this case, you would need to hire an office cleaning crew. Because office cleaning crews involve high-turnovers, business owners must be prepared to fill-in when a worker is ill or suddenly quits. Prior to opening your cleaning service for business, obtain a business license and insurance.

Office cleaning businesses can be up and running with little out-of-pocket expense. Supplies required include:

- Disinfected Cleaner (Clorox, Windex, bleach, etc)

- Duster

- Vacuum

- Mop

- Bucket

- Broom and Dust Pan

- Toilet Brush

- Trash Bags

Any small or large office business is a potential client. Initially, you may want to begin with smaller offices and gradually grow your business to include bigger offices. Prospective clients include:

- Chiropractic offices

- Dentists offices

- Other Medical offices

- Real estate offices

- Hair Salons

- Childcare Centers

Web designing has become the in thing today. There are hordes of web designers and web designing companies across the globe ready to flaunt their designing skills and innovations with latest techniques of designing. But all said and done web designing is not as easy and simple as it seems. There is much thought process to be done before the actual web designing commences. The following are the questions are to be considered before designing your web site:

What is the purpose of your business? What is the market situation for your product or service? What is the problem area that you need to address? What is your overall marketing strategy? What is your marketing plan? Who are your competitors and what is their strategy? What are your priority markets? Whom do you wish to target? What budget do you allocate to promotions and advertising? What would be the role of Internet advertising? What are the goals you wish to accomplish through your web site? Do you wish to have the web site just for the sake of having it? Or do you have a clear vision and purpose to have the web site? Do you take the web designing seriously?

Ideally one should have the clarity of thoughts and action on all the above areas to come to the decision of designing a web site. The web design should be such that it serves the basic purpose of your business and it appeals to your target audience wherever they are there across the globe. You need to know your target audience, and keep them in mind throughout the web development process. Say clearly what you want to convey, concisely and focused on what they want and plan to give them all the information they need.

Your web site content is the most powerful aspect of your website’s presentation — more than anything else. Creating effective text will bring you the response you expect from your visitors. If your website is well written, it’s guaranteed to be more successful than sites that rely on mediocre writing, no matter how amazing their graphics may look. It takes some work! Please note one thing — if you expect success, your text needs to be clear by each and every word!

Presentation Of web site: When you start to develop graphical concepts for your site, remember the benefits of simplicity. It’s easy to get carried away with web graphics, but having too many flashy visuals can be very distracting — and they can take ages for browsers to load. You are developing website to give information about your company not to show the designing skills of your web designers. Even limited use of images and graphics can create a wonderful site if used smartly.

Smooth Surfing: Avoid links that makes the visitor to leave your site. Make the links for only those pages that are very important for you to promote your business or visitor must know. Good web navigation helps people to orient themselves in your website and find what they’re looking for. Each page should also give your visitor easy access to all of the features of your site. There are many options for laying out your menus for the web site design but it’s vital to keep your navigation simple, clear and consistent throughout your site. The visitor should be very comfortable with your web site whether he reads or navigates through your site.

No page counters: Page counters do nothing except make you look like an amateur, mess with your design and tell competitors about your site you probably don’t want them to know! If you want to know how many people are visiting your site, just ask your web hosting company for the server stats.

Focus on result orientation: You are more concerned with the result, regardless of the technology used by your designer. Avoid using back ground music on web page as music file is pretty heavy and takes time to down load. You should focus more on content on web pages to generate inquires rather than entertaining visitor by placing undesired flash, music, marquee, animation etc.

 

Avoid using framesets in website: It is very easy to design frame based website for any web design company. This takes less time to design and does not require any type of extra designing skills but it will make site very complicated and at times cause listing problem with search engines. This shall also help your site to become search engine friendly site.

Maintain consistency in web pages structure throughout the website: do not take web site as your company or product brochure. Some designers recommend creating a different structure of their web pages within same web site. People always enjoy consistency of a stream of water continuously flowing with the same speed and flow! The same is the case with your web site visitor. Let him experience the same flow and design pattern of all your pages throughout the site. That’s why all successful and famous sites have the same look and feel.

Create site map page:

A site map is a simple web page with text links to all the websites sub-pages organized in proper categories; a lot of people will use a site map if they can find one. Site map is very useful to guide visitors to make them reach to the destination page. Site map for web site will also be helpful if you wish to optimize your web pages for the search engines.

Make your titles on your web page: One of the core attributes of a web page is its title. In between the tags you can specify the page’s title as it appears in the browsers top title bar and in the search engine results. Visitor pay attention to the TITLE of the web page when that page is listed in the search engines. This indeed is a very crucial and sensitive issue while you write the title for that web page. If it is not written improperly you might end up losing many visitors because they could not judge whether you site would be carrying the information they want!

Under construction pages: If your page is not ready do not put it up and promote. It is indeed a very irritating experience when the surfer gets to your site after searching from the search engine and gets frustrated on seeing a dead page or the instruction that your site is under process. Don’t lose your visitor even before he has seen your site! If you have links that are pointing to the pages which are not ready, disable them until your page is ready. Or you can link that page to the contact us page till pages are ready so that visitor may contact you for the information about that particular product or services in future when he needs them.

Color: Avoid using too many colors in your web site: Color is a way the visitor of the web site identifies things. Keep the color scheme of your web site limited to a couple of colors and keep it consistent across your site unless you want to demonstrate some colorful presentation. Reading a text with too many colors will create strain to the eyes and visitor will try to skip that text rater than reading thoroughly.

 

Do provide alternate text (using the ‘alt’ attribute of the image tag) for all important images of the website:

Alternate text is text that you insert in your image tags that is used by text only browsers. You should put meaningful information in the alternative text that will benefit those who can’t see and it will also help you with the search engine optimization process as search engine spider can not read images. It can only read text which is being incorporated in your web design.
